Performance Characteristics of Plastic Gear Wheels
- Lightweight: Being significantly lighter than metal gears, plastic gears reduce the overall weight of machinery, leading to improved efficiency and reduced energy consumption.
- Corrosion Resistance: Plastic gears do not rust, making them ideal for use in environments exposed to moisture and chemical agents.
- Lower Noise Levels: Plastic gears operate more quietly compared to their metal counterparts, which is beneficial in applications where noise reduction is crucial.
- Cost-Effective: The production cost of plastic gears is generally lower than that of metal gears due to cheaper material and manufacturing processes.
- Versatility: Plastic gears can be molded into complex shapes and sizes, providing designers with greater flexibility.
Types and Characteristics of Plastic Gear Wheels
Plastic gear wheels come in various types, each with unique properties tailored to specific applications.

- Nylon Gears: Known for their high strength and flexibility, nylon gears are widely used in applications requiring durability.
- Acetal Gears: These gears offer excellent dimensional stability and low friction, making them suitable for precision applications.
- Polycarbonate Gears: With their high impact resistance and transparency, polycarbonate gears are ideal for applications requiring both strength and visual inspection.
Applications in Various Industries
Plastic gear wheels are integral to several industries due to their unique advantages.
- Automotive Manufacturing: Used in dashboard instruments, window regulators, and seat adjusters, plastic gears contribute to weight reduction and fuel efficiency.
- Consumer Electronics: Found in devices like printers, scanners, and cameras, plastic gears help in miniaturization and noise reduction.
- Medical Devices: In medical pumps and diagnostic equipment, plastic gears ensure precision and reliability.
- Industrial Machinery: Plastic gears are employed in conveyor systems and robotic arms due to their durability and low maintenance.
- Household Appliances: Used in washing machines, mixers, and vacuum cleaners, plastic gears reduce noise and enhance performance.
